- Abstract
The aspect of use adaptive artificial neural net in autopilot is considered with reference to a task of the external disturbances compensation on a launch vehicle. Under the external disturbances the random process of wind action is considered. One of the relevant issues for future space transportation systems is the controlling forces minimization during compensating perturbations. During the flight it can be reached by an operative estimation and prediction of the perturbation. For this purpose the using of adaptive neural net is offered. The selected algorithm of adaptation uses the algorithm of inverse error propagation. The example of an autopilot with using of a neuron network at the representation of wind perturbation as random process is considered.
